How did Issac Newton help progress the world in the Age of Reason, and how did his work help shape the world we see today?

History
1 answer:
11111nata11111 [884]2 years ago
3 0

Answer:

Newton discovered the laws of gravity, motion, & created a new branch of mathematics - calculus. He discovered gravity, this is the calculus branch of mathematics. Isaac Newton changed the way we understand the Universe. Revered in his own lifetime, he discovered the laws of gravity and motion and invented calculus. He helped to shape our rational world view. But Newton's story is also one of a monstrous ego who believed that he alone was able to understand God's creation.
